Time line
Submission April 6
Upfront medicals passed April 11
Biometric passed April 13
PPR June 1st

Documents
Sop
IMM forms
Admission letter from university of Alberta
Passport
POF was Scholarships letter from department
Parents statement of Account

Additional docs (not much actually)
Nin of myself and family
Family photo
Cv
Bsc Transcript
Bsc Certificate
Birth certificate
Accademic awards
Police certificate.

If the business is not registered before, there is no point registering it now for visa application sake because you don't have a corporate account for the business to show how busy the business and account is.

My advice is leave the business out of the visa application process.

Although if you register it now, it's not a stain but will add no weight to your application.

Alternatively, you don't necessarily have to register your business to use it as an evidence of self employment if the business has a license. For example, POS business may not be registered by CAC but the operator can show mobile money agent license or certificate and bank agency certificate and SANEF certificate. SANEF is a government body regulating mobile money.

A petty loan/savings collector (Ajo) may not register with CAC (he cannot register unless as a cooperative society or finance company) but can present a Lagos State Government license. Lagos State has started issuing license to petty loan operators.

My point is while CAC is the parent authority responsible for registration of businesses, Corporate entities etc, government licenses or delegated authority from an international entity can also be used to legally identify and recognize an entity.

I submitted my study visa application online with 2 children visit visa on 31st of March 2022, 13 days after (excluding public holidays) my submission IRCC sent a medical request for the 3 application. The following day I receive another letter to provide my police clearance which wasn’t submitted with my application and I was giving 25 days to submit it.
I encourage everyone don’t give up God will do it, do your application yourself and submit genuine document. All the document you needed for your application is here on this forum if you can read from part 1 to the last the last part of this forum.

Below are documents submitted for my SV

STUDY VISA REQUIREMENTS (Applicants Personal Documents)
1. IRCC Online Application (1st April 2022)
2. Biometric Date (8th April 2022)
3. IRCC Medical Request – 21/04/2022 (13 days after submission excluding public holidays and weekend)
4. IRCC Police Clearance Request (2nd day after medical request)
5. IRCC Passport Request (15th May 2022)
6. School Seneca College (2 years Diploma – Accounting & Payroll CO-OP)
7. Seneca College Unconditional Official Letter of admission
8. Age – 37 years
9. Tuition receipts of 1st year ($16,000)
10. Copy of my South Africa Permanent Resident Permit
11. Copy of my South Africa I.D book
12. Copy of Applicant’s international passport bio data page (Still bear my father’s name)
13. Copy of police character certificate
14. Copy of West African Examinations Council Senior School Certificate
15. Copy of applicant’s international passport bio data page with previous visa
16. Copy of applicant’s family picture
17. SOP - Statement of purpose (1 and half pages)
18. Marriage certificate
19. Degree Certificate ( Bsc Accounting)
20. Transcripts
21. Professional Membership Certificates
22. Employment Letter (Letter of Employment)
23. Letter of introduction from employer
24. Recommendation Letter from employer
25. Study leave letter
26. Paid study leave approval with 30% salary been given while on study leave ( Letter stating employee coming back to the company to continue her job)
27. Work ID card
28. Resume (CV)
29. Payslips (5 months)
30. 1 year bank statement of account with bank reference letter.
31. Proof of loan from the bank
32. Husband Payslips
33. Husband Work ID
34. Husband – South Africa Permanent Resident Permit
35. Husband – South Africa I.D book
36. Husband Birth certificate and international passport bio data page with travel history
37. Children’s birth certificate and international passport bio data page
38. Wedding picture/family pictures
39. Properties Document (South Africa & Nigeria)
40. Husband Consent Letter
41. Letter of explanation for lump sum in my account with proof of payment (All this money came in within a month of my submission)

STUDY VISA REQUIREMENTS (Sponsors Personal Documents)
1. Sponsorship letter
2. Letter of financial support
3. Affidavit of sponsorship
4. Sponsor 3 month’s payslips
5. Sponsor 5 months bank statement (less than 4 million naira) with reference letter from bank
6. Sponsor Passport data page with travel history
7. Sponsor employment letter
8. Sponsor birth certificate (my elder brother with both surname)
